Output 8526d9684aaaae9593367f12a40c88f7e15cd5d3bfe3daf7014f8fbd838e2b6e:1

value
120517970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 627185c81a13b507eb23b0f20130d22c69b1cd20 OP_EQUALVERIFY OP_CHECKSIG
address
LUCUUhYYp4aeRUMinNFjK3uR5ZpbNcoCTT
transaction
8526d9684aaaae9593367f12a40c88f7e15cd5d3bfe3daf7014f8fbd838e2b6e
spent
true